This is where i bought my one betta (Helios) and due to the long shipping time, they sent me a free betta (Same color, they're actually brothers..) BUT the brother (Apollo) Came to me with fin rot.

I bought Helios off Aquabid, thinking i'd be buying from a quality source. SOooo- I just wanted to let you know of Betta Kingdom. They store their fish in 1 gallon tanks in a warehouse and they've got 6 breeders working for them. Shipment is supposed to be a 2-day shipping standard, but i got my fish after 7 days of paying. And because of the late delivery, they sent me a free fish (Which wasn't all that healthy anyways)
